About Nur Ibrahim
Nur Ibrahim is a scholar working on Information Systems, Artificial Intelligence, Computer Vision and Pattern Recognition, Food Science and Aerospace Engineering, having authored 54 papers that have together received 327 indexed citations. Recurring topics across this work include Computer Science and Engineering (11 papers), Data Mining and Machine Learning Applications (10 papers), Food and Agricultural Sciences (6 papers), Spectroscopy and Chemometric Analyses (4 papers), Technology Adoption and User Behaviour (4 papers), Blockchain Technology in Education and Learning (4 papers), Advanced Steganography and Watermarking Techniques (3 papers) and Vehicle License Plate Recognition (3 papers). The work is most often cited by research in Information Systems and Management (35 citations), Surfaces, Coatings and Films (18 citations), Artificial Intelligence (74 citations), Water Science and Technology (32 citations) and Business and International Management (4 citations). Nur Ibrahim has collaborated with scholars based in Indonesia, Malaysia and South Korea. Frequent co-authors include Suresh K. Bhatia, Sumathi Sethupathi, Abdul Latif Ahmad, Yunendah Nur Fuadah, Benyamin Kusumoputro, Syamsul Rizal, Ledya Novamizanti, Muhammad Khusairi Osman, Sharifah Hanis Yasmin Sayid Abdullah and Inung Wijayanto. Their work appears in journals such as Information Technology and People, IEEE Access, International Journal of Information and Learning Technology, Technology in Society and Heliyon.
